Design outcomes

Primary

MeasureTime frame
Assessment of preparation quality following visual training using either a holographic three-dimensional (3D) representation or a conventional two-dimensional (2D) representation based on a veneer preparation performed on a phantom model. Two independent, blinded, and calibrated dentists (MJ, CS) objectively evaluate the preparations using a standardized assessment scheme comprising criteria such as shape, preparation depth, design, and preparation margins. The study investigates whether the mode of visualization (holographic 3D versus conventional 2D) has a significant effect on the quality of the veneer preparation.

Secondary

MeasureTime frame
Changes in preparation quality within each group before and after the respective visualization phase are analyzed to assess individual learning progress and the impact of the visualization modality on practical performance, independent of the between-group comparison. In addition, students provide a subjective evaluation of the visualization modalities using a standardized questionnaire. Assessed domains include usability, comprehensibility, spatial understanding, perceived educational effectiveness, and personal preference.
